

Being in shape for skiing and snowboarding can make the difference between an unforgettable day on the mountain and one spent sitting in the lodge nursing exhausted legs. Skiing and riding demand a combination of strength, balance, coordination, power, mobility, and endurance. Whether you plan to spend significant time on the mountain or just a few days a year, your body needs to be prepared for hours of repeated physical effort.
A skier can be incredibly strong and still become exhausted halfway through the day. Once fatigue sets in, technique can deteriorate, turns can become less precise, and the ability to absorb bumps and uneven terrain can suffer. That’s where cardiovascular conditioning comes in.
One of the simplest ways to build that aerobic foundation is through steady-state cardio, often referred to as Zone 2 cardio. And the good news is it doesn’t require fancy equipment, brutal intervals, or hours in the gym. For skiers and snowboarders, some relatively easy work can pay major dividends when it’s time to shred the mountain.
What is Steady State Cardio (SSC)?
Steady state cardio is a form of cardiovascular exercise performed at a low to moderate intensity that can be sustained for an extended period. The idea is relatively simple: instead of repeatedly pushing yourself to your maximum, you maintain a consistent effort that allows your aerobic energy system to do most of the work.

Of the five heart rate training zones, SSC falls into Zone 2, which is why Zone 2 is a common term for this type of training. At this intensity, your body can continue exercising for a long time without the dramatic fatigue associated with high-intensity efforts.
As a general guideline, Zone 2 is most commonly defined as roughly 60 to 70 percent of maximum heart rate. The exact heart rate range varies from person to person, which is why simply plugging your age into a formula isn’t always the most accurate way to determine your Zone 2. Your actual Zone 2 can be higher or lower depending on your fitness level, genetics, training history, and how your maximum heart rate is determined.

The Benefits of Steady State Cardio for Skiers and Snowboarders
It Builds the Aerobic Engine Behind a Long Ski Day
A day on the mountain may not look like a traditional endurance event, but skiing and snowboarding require hours of repeated physical effort. From run after run to traverses, hikes, and lift rides, your cardiovascular and muscular systems are constantly working.
A stronger aerobic system helps your body use oxygen more efficiently, allowing you to stay active longer before fatigue sets in. This can help you maintain your technique late into the ski day as it takes longer for your muscles to fatigue. Whether you’re chasing 125,000 vertical feet in a day or simply trying to keep up with your kids, SSC can help you make the most of a full day on the mountain.
It Helps You Recover Both On and Off the Mountain
Skiing isn’t a steady-state activity in itself. Steep pitches, moguls, trees, and powder require intense bursts of effort, followed by recovery on the chairlift or easier terrain. A strong aerobic system helps your body recover between those efforts, allowing you to ski hard, recover faster, and do it again throughout the day.
SSC can also be an excellent option on recovery days because it gets you moving without adding the same stress as another high-intensity workout. It allows your muscles and nervous system to recover from harder training sessions as well as assist in maintaining your aerobic conditioning without interfering with the recovery needed to build strength and power. It can also help with muscle soreness.


It Helps Manage Weight and Burn Fat
For skiers and snowboarders, maintaining a healthy body weight can make moving around the mountain easier, reduce the energy required for every turn and climb, and help you stay fresher during long days on the slopes. Whether you carry a lot of extra weight or are trying to make your abs pop, a little fat loss (and muscle gain) is always a good thing.
SSC can be a useful tool for managing body weight and supporting fat loss, especially because it can be performed regularly without the recovery demands of high-intensity training. Zone 2 is considered the fat-burning zone, and while no single form of exercise guarantees fat loss, consistent aerobic activity increases energy expenditure and can help create the calorie deficit needed to lose excess body fat.
How to Find and Measure Your Zone 2 Heart Rate
There are several ways to estimate your Zone 2 heart rate, but it’s important to understand that heart rate formulas are estimates, not precise measurements.
First, you will want to estimate your maximum heart rate using the following formula:
220 minus your age = estimated maximum heart rate
From there, you can calculate roughly 60 to 70 percent of that number as a general Zone 2 range. For example, a 40-year-old person using that formula would have an estimated maximum heart rate of 180 beats per minute. Sixty to 70 percent would put their estimated Zone 2 heart rate between approximately 108 and 126 beats per minute. However, that number shouldn’t be treated as gospel. Two people of the same age can have significantly different maximum heart rates depending on their fitness level and other factors.
There are a number of ways to measure your heart rate to determine what training zone you are in.
Heart rate monitors can be convenient and valuable, but can also vary in accuracy, particularly wrist-based monitors during certain activities.
Another way is to feel your heart rate, either on your neck or wrist, and count the beats for six seconds while watching a timer. Multiply this number by 10 to get your heart rate. To be a bit more accurate, count the beats for 10 seconds and multiply that number by six.


There’s also a remarkably simple way to determine whether you’re likely in Zone 2: the talk test. During an SSC workout, you should be able to speak in short, complete sentences. You should be breathing noticeably harder than you would while sitting on the couch, but you shouldn’t be gasping for air. If you can carry on a conversation using short sentences but wouldn’t want to deliver a speech or sing a song, you’re probably around the right intensity.
What Activities Can You Do for SSC?
The good news is that almost any rhythmic cardiovascular activity can become SSC training if you maintain the appropriate intensity.
Cycling is an excellent option for skiers because it provides a low-impact way to build aerobic fitness while spending time outdoors. Road cycling, mountain biking, stationary bikes, and spin bikes can all work. Electric bikes can be particularly helpful for keeping your heart rate in Zone 2 because you can adjust the pedal assist to make sure you don’t exert too much energy and spike your heart rate too high.
Hiking is another great choice, particularly for mountain athletes. Hiking uphill adds some muscular endurance while increasing your heart rate. Just adjust your pace so that you remain in your target zone. Brisk walking may be all you need, but a slight incline could be required to elevate the heart rate enough. Jogging and trail running are also effective options for people who enjoy running. Just remember that the goal is aerobic conditioning, not setting a personal recored. Slow down if necessary.
Ultimately, any activity can be modified or intensified to achieve an SSC workout. I love basketball, so shooting hoops in the backyard while moving the entire time is great for me. You can also modify your HIIT workouts to keep your heart rate in Zone 2, hustle through your round of disc golf, or even use yoga with a fast flow. The possibilities are endless. Just aim for 30 to 45 minutes per workout a couple of times a week. As your fitness improves, you can gradually increase the duration.


Strength Training Is Still King
While SSC is valuable for building endurance, it shouldn’t overshadow strength training and a balanced fitness plan, which are more important for preparing skiers and snowboarders for the demands of the mountain. Skiing and snowboarding require strength to absorb and control terrain, power to make quick movements, and endurance to keep going throughout a long day.
A solid training program should combine strength training, cardio, power, plyometrics, mobility, flexibility, and balance work to prepare your body for the wide range of demands you’ll encounter on the mountain.
There are also plenty of other activities that can complement your training, including yoga, Pilates, and other forms of movement. The goal isn’t to become great at one type of exercise, but to build a well-rounded body that is strong, powerful, mobile, and resilient. SSC can be an important piece of the puzzle, but it works best as part of a balanced fitness program that helps you ski stronger, move better, and stay healthy throughout the season.
SSC isn’t a magic bullet, and it certainly shouldn’t replace a well-rounded fitness routine of strength training, power work, mobility, or other forms of conditioning. Instead, think of SSC as another tool in your ski fitness toolbox, helping build the aerobic foundation that allows you to recover faster, manage fatigue, and make the most of long days on the mountain.
